Initial evaluation

Testing context sensitivity and evidence calibration

I tested the V1 rubric against three deliberately different cases: emotionally compelling self-report, explicit roleplay, and an ordinary assistant disclaimer.

Initial result

3/3 expected outcomes

Test caseExpected behaviourActual resultOutcome

Emotional self-report

Fear, shutdown and death-related language produced after a leading prompt.

Identify strong anthropomorphic cues while treating a single prompted response as weak evidence.

0/100 evidence

20/35 cue intensity

Correctly classified as prompt-shaped output.

Pass

Explicit roleplay

A fictional conscious spaceship AI claiming sensation, embodiment and fear of erasure.

Recognise vivid consciousness-like language while using the roleplay instruction as a strong alternative explanation.

0/100 evidence

16/35 cue intensity

Explicit roleplay and prompt shaping were correctly identified.

Pass

Ordinary assistant disclaimer

A standard chatbot response denying feelings, awareness and subjective experience.

Produce a very low cue score and no meaningful evidence of consciousness.

9/100 evidence

3/35 cue intensity

Correct verdict, with a minor calibration question caused by routine first-person assistant language.

Pass with note

What the initial evaluation demonstrated

Across all three cases, the system separated consciousness-like cue intensity from evidential strength. The emotional self-report and explicit roleplay examples contained strong consciousness-like language but were correctly assessed as providing no meaningful evidence of consciousness. The ordinary assistant disclaimer produced very low cue intensity and the correct overall verdict.

The reports were also internally consistent: the verdict, evidence score, contextual assessment and explanation of what stronger evidence would require all supported the same conclusion.

Calibration finding

The ordinary assistant disclaimer received a small non-zero evidence score because routine phrases such as “I can help” and “I generate responses” were interpreted as weak agency and self-model cues. The overall verdict remained correct, but this identifies an area for further rubric calibration and regression testing.

Product walkthrough

From contextual input to an explainable report

Users submit an AI response together with the preceding prompt, product setting and any additional context. The application then produces a structured report separating consciousness-like cues from evidential strength.
